Emma's Review:

Jarvik is the last brother to find his mate in Jianne Carlo's Viking Warriors series. Known as The Seducer, Jarvik is a strong and sensual man. Elaina is his match in every way. Her sexuality is well hidden but clearly there. I loved the plot for this story. It has all scorching sex that we have come to expect from this series as well as a creative and intriguing storyline. We are reunited with all the brothers and their families. The loyalty and love amongst them is so appealing. It's also wonderful to experience the smouldering chemistry that still exists between the men and their wives even after the passage of time.The story wouldn't be complete without intrigue, schemes and a near death experience. Humor and true affection tie this family together and I can't remember the last time so enjoyed the final book in a series. The kids are great fun and it is a very poignant moment when the women stand to together to make a powerful statement to Elaina. This is one passionate and exciting series and I highly recommend starting at the beginning and experiencing the entire saga. If you love those Vikings, don't miss these fantastic stories.

Emma's Review:
Magnus is on his way to meet his betrothed when he saves a maid from a lecherous attack. He's beguiled by the woman but destined for another. Deidre has no wish to marry the man known as 'The Destroyer'. She is drawn to forest and its creatures. To avoid the marriage she dons a disguise and leaves the safety of her family. Rescued by a huge scarred warrior, Deidre is drawn in by his sensuality and gentleness. But now she fears what will happen when the warrior discovers that she is his bride.

Despite it's ominous title The Destroyer, this is fun, fanciful and sexy read. I love Magnus and found his vulnerability concerning his size and scars very endearing. I'm not sure I've ever taken to a character as quickly and completely as I did to Deidre/Daisy. Without a lick of caution or guile, she's just a breath of fresh air. And while the entire story is much more fantasy than fact, it is delightfully entertaining. Raw sensuality jumps from the pages when Magnus and Deidre come together. The animal scenes are sweet and add a touch of humor. I highly recommend the entire series and I do hope there are more stories to come. (Fiona could really use a man).

Emma's Review:
Njal is known as the Peacemaker, renowned for his diplomatic skill. Bettina is warrior woman bent on seeking vengeance. When the two meet, it's a less than auspicious occasion. They are forced to marry and try to forge an understanding. Neither is what the other wanted, but ultimately, they find a passion neither knew existed.

I love this series. I'm a big fan of erotic historical romance and this author is one of the reasons why. Bettina is an awesome character and while Njal is a bit stuffy, I learned to appreciate his finer qualities. There's plenty of steamy sex, but Bettina and Njal work well outside the bedroom too. The dialogue and setting lend the 'Viking' to this story. This is entertaining and saucy read. I've enjoyed watching the brothers meet their matches and can't wait for the next one.
